Chronicles of Narnia
It is an unfortunate circumstance that the new movie ‘ The Lion, The Witch, and The Wardrobe’ was immediately taken in by many people as very much the same type of movie as the Lord of the Rings trilogy. This comparison went perhaps as deep for most people as the fact that it was released in mid December and that the same special effects company worked on it. (That being WETA) The fact is, there are many similarities and comparisons to be made between the Chronicles of Narnia and the Lord of the Rings, but the movies themselves are two beasts of a different color. Star Wreck: The Pirkinning is a full length parody science fiction movie made entirely by some Finns and a lot of computers. It is a fan made film, but from the dead on computer generated ships, you might not know it until you actually saw the actors. [Read the rest of this article]
